Primary Visual Cortex
The part of the occipital lobes that processes visual information from the eyes.
Periaqueductal Gray
A region of the midbrain involved in pain modulation, decision-making, and autonomic functions, crucial for the body's fight or flee response.
Temporal Lobe
A region of the cerebral cortex associated with processing auditory information, as well as playing key roles in memory and speech.
